C++ 实例 - 计算自然数之和

计算 1+2+3+....+n 的和。

实例

#include <bits/stdc++.h>
using namespace std;
 
int main() {
  
    int n, sum = 0;
    // 输入一个正整数
    cin >> n;
 
    for (int i = 1; i <= n; ++i) {
        sum += i;
    }
    // 输出结果
    cout << sum << endl;
    return 0;
}

以上程序执行输出结果为:

50
1275